Bolognese Crispy Rice Dolsot Bibimbap Bowls

Savory, saucy meat sauce on top of fluffy rice in a hot stone bowl, topped off with cheese and a slow poached egg.
Prep Time10 minutes
Cook Time10 minutes
Total Time20 minutes
Course: main
Cuisine: Italian, korean
Keyword: dolsot bibimbap
Servings: 2

Equipment

  • Stone Bowl

Ingredients

  • 1 tsp oil for the stone bowl
  • 1-2 cups white rice how much depends on the size of your bowl
  • 1/4 cup shredded mozzarella
  • 1/2 cup bolognese sauce
  • 1 slow poached egg
  • Parmigiano Reggiano cheese grated
  • fresh flat leaf parsley finely chopped

Instructions

  • Heat up a stone bowl, lightly oiled, over medium-low heat until very hot.

  • Add the rice to the pot, and top with cheese and sauce. Place the egg on top and make it rain parmesan. Add parsley, if using.

  • If you’re serving it at the table, carefully bring the bowl to the table. Mix everything up, pushing the rice up the sides of the bowl. You should hear a bit of a sizzle. Let crisp for a couple of minutes. The mix of rice and cheese will form a crispy frico/socarrat. The longer you wait, the crispier it will get. Enjoy!

Notes

Feel free to use your favorite bolognese sauce and type of egg. I had some slow poached eggs in the fridge, so it worked out well for me, but a simple soft boiled egg or crispy sunny side up egg would work just as well.
